Transaction 85bac70edafe32f6a8321331ab5652eb4dfd559466c1f5de8784611b07fcb63a

1 Input
2 Outputs
  • 85bac70edafe32f6a8321331ab5652eb4dfd559466c1f5de8784611b07fcb63a:0
  • value  203258
    address  3KNCtf7p1ZRUjcDycSf4izdf5W6QwBHPdY
  • 85bac70edafe32f6a8321331ab5652eb4dfd559466c1f5de8784611b07fcb63a:1
  • value  78714014
    address  3HRZjedwF2AJejNTtgznWnas4E6froNP5r